Output c588b05c17f58cb5cdc3dd249923a4f879c59cd8c0571b2b0d4c44afafe1305a:16

value
15410305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c68545156d84e2478108d1a799491653dd74df1 OP_EQUAL
address
3LKpkcFb1xXtEc21FP8Pc6FckkBnrzt6XK
transaction
c588b05c17f58cb5cdc3dd249923a4f879c59cd8c0571b2b0d4c44afafe1305a
spent
true